Most searches for how much money you can earn from online surveys in India want one number. Here it is: realistic survey income per hour in India runs Rs 100-400, and an active member earns Rs 500-8,000 a month. Nobody earns a full-time salary from surveys; treat any bigger claim as a red flag.

The Short Answer: Realistic Earnings, Per Hour and Per Month

Strip away the hype, and the honest range looks like this:

Per survey: Rs 50–500, depending on survey type and whether you qualify

Effective per hour: Rs 100–400 of genuinely engaged time

Light user: Rs 300–600 a month (1–3 short surveys)

Regular user: Rs 1,500–3,000 a month (8–15 activities, mixed length)

Power user: Rs 5,000–8,000 a month (30+ activities, multiple study types)

The variation isn't random; it's driven by five controllable factors, covered next. For how rewards are calculated and paid out, see the reward policy (/reward-policy).

What Decides Your Earnings? The 5 Variables

Two people who join on the same day can land in completely different earning brackets within months. Here's what actually separates them:

Profile depth. A thin profile qualifies for almost nothing beyond generic polls. A detailed, honest, updated profile unlocks higher-paying studies.

Geography. Under-represented cities, states, or a rural/urban split often get more, and better-paying, invitations.

Incidence rate. Narrow-audience studies screen out most people fast, so researchers pay more per completed response.

Survey length. Longer pays more in rupees, but not always more per hour; track your real Rs/hour, not the headline reward.

Redemption speed & method. Redeeming promptly and understanding thresholds via rewards (/rewards), gives you an accurate read on real earnings.

Reward Per Survey: A Real Breakdown Table

Not all “surveys” are the same activity. Here's roughly what each format pays:

Activity Type Typical Duration Typical Reward (Rs) Effective Rs/Hour
Quick poll 3–5 min 20–50 240–600
Standard survey 10–15 min 80–150 320–600
In-depth study 30–45 min 250–500 330–670
Focus group / interview 45–90 min 800–2,500 1,000–1,700

Key takeaways:

  • Shorter activities often beat long ones on effective hourly rate.
  • Focus groups pay the most per hour but are the least frequent opportunity.
  • Mix all four formats rather than chasing only the single highest reward.

Why “Rs 50,000 A Month” Claims Are False (And Who Profits From Them)

Search “how much can earn through online survey” and you'll find claims of Rs 30,000–Rs 50,000 a month. These don't hold up: survey rewards are funded by research budgets sized for a statistically useful number of responses, not to pay any one participant a living wage.

Even at the high end (Rs 400/hour, 8 hours a day) no platform has enough matching studies to sustain that volume for one person. Genuine top earners hit Rs 5,000–9,000/month across several hours a week, not one working day.

Red flags that a “high-paying survey” claim isn't legitimate:

  • Asks for payment before you've earned anything
  • Can't name a specific study, client, or research purpose
  • Reward structure is vague, unpublished, or inconsistent
  • Promises a fixed high income regardless of effort or matching

A legitimate panel never charges a joining fee, never asks for payment to “unlock” surveys, and ties every reward to a specific, visible completed activity.

Surveys vs. Other No-Investment Side Income: Effective Rs/Hour

Surveys are one of several genuinely no-investment ways to earn online in India:

Activity Typical Rs/Hour Notes
Online surveys 100–400 No skill barrier; rate varies by survey type
Micro-tasking (tagging, transcription) 80–200 Often needs app installs; variable task supply
Content writing (entry-level, gigs) 150–350 Needs writing skill; inconsistent client flow
Basic data entry (freelance) 100–250 Low skill barrier, high competition
Focus groups / paid interviews 800–1,700 Highest rate, but infrequent & criteria-restricted

 

  • Surveys sit mid-range on effort vs. reward, with zero skill barrier and no client-hunting required.

How To Move From Bottom Quartile To Top Quartile: 7 Actions

  1. Complete every profile section, not just mandatory fields—optional questions unlock niche, higher-paying studies.
  2. Respond within hours, not days—studies close once they hit their target response count.
  3. Keep your profile current after every job change, move, or major purchase.
  4. Track your effective Rs/hour, not just the headline reward, and prioritize accordingly.
  5. Say yes to focus groups and interviews—they pay the most per hour but are offered less often.
  6. Answer honestly and consistently—quality tracking affects how often you're matched to future studies.
  7. Redeem on a regular schedule and know the thresholds via rewards (/rewards).

Members who follow all seven for 2–3 months typically see more invitations and higher average value per invitation.

What Surveys Will NOT Do: Honest Limitations

  • Will not replace a salary or full-time income — there aren't enough matching studies to fill a working week.
  • Will not pay out instantly in most cases — rewards process after a study closes and responses are validated.
  • Will not pay the same amount every month — availability depends on live research demand.
  • Will not work well as your only income stream — treat it as supplementary, not primary, income.

FAQ

Can I earn Rs 10,000 a month from online surveys?

For most members, no—that's above what even power users typically earn (Rs 5,000–9,000). Possible in an exceptional month, but not a repeatable target.

Is this a full-time income?

No. Study availability depends on live market research demand, which isn't large enough to fill a full working week for any one person.

How fast is the first payout?

Depends on the study and redemption method. Short polls credit quickly; longer studies take more time for validation. See the reward policy (/reward-policy) for exact timelines.

Do I need a laptop?

No. Most surveys work on a smartphone browser. Focus groups or video interviews may need a stable connection and a camera.

Is it free to join?

Yes. Creating a profile costs nothing, and no legitimate panel ever charges a fee to “unlock” surveys.
